Exploratory Development of Coated Fabric for Firefighters' Protective Clothing.

Abstract

The objective of the work was to improve the durability of the aluminized fabric currently used for the outer layer of fireffighters' proximity coats. Two possible improvements were developed: (a) Substituting a Viton/bronze coating for the aluminum, and adding a topcoat of pigmented urethane to improve wear resistance; (b) Adding a topcoat of pigmented urethane to the aluminized fabric to improve wear resistance. Sample lengths of both types of coated fabric were produced.
